Wildlife Encounters in Botswana
Botswana is a top safari destination thanks to its wildlife, which is among the most diverse and accessible in Africa and is blessed with some of the world’s most amazing natural spectacles. Botswana has more elephants than any other country, big cats wander freely, and a wide variety of animals, including the critically endangered African wild dog, aquatic antelopes, rhinos, and a variety of birds. Birdwatching Spectacular:
Botswana is a haven for serious birdwatchers with over 590 different kinds of birds. Numerous permanent and migratory bird species, such as the magnificent African fish eagle and the colorful lilac-breasted roller, are drawn to the wetlands of the Okavango Delta.

Memorable Aquatic Encounters:
The waterways in Botswana are home to one of Africa’s most powerful and largest hippo populations. Nothing beats the sight of these animals yawning and stretching their mouths wide up from the water. You will also in addition spot the famous Nile Crocodile. If you are a fishing fanatic then prepare yourself to catch Africa’s finest bream and tigerfish as well as other small water creatures.

The Safari Experience: Game drives and more
With all the wildlife and incredible animals to see in Botswana, there is nothing like the perfect Botswana Safari Experience to complete the exciting all-round trip. There are so many ways in which you can enjoy your Safari.
- Game drive – Enjoy a safari in a 4×4 vehicle through some of Botswana’s best National Parks. The Vehicle allows you to explore a large portion of the Park and spot more animals in their natural habitat. The drive through the sand and rocky terrain will give you an African massage that adds a touch of adventure to the safari.
- Walking Safari – Have you ever tried a walking safari? Unlike the game drive, you will experience the safari on foot. You will be accompanied by professional guides and experts as you track some of the wild’s fierce beasts. The vehicle makes a lot of noise that scares away animals at times but on foot, you get an up-close experience that you wouldn’t have otherwise seen in a vehicle.
- Cruise and Canoeing – Whether you are in the northern part of Botswana in the Chobe region or you are in the beautiful Okavango Delta you will definitely spend some time close to the water where you spot the amazing aquatic wildlife. The best way to do so is to go on a relaxing cruise or the unique canoe or mokoro ride in the Okavango.
- Horseback safaris – A horseback safari is one of the most unique ways to spot wildlife and see the area. It is a different experience and makes you see the environment in a different way. We highly recommend this activity.
